Department Profile
From global institutions to hedge funds, investors come to Morgan Stanley for sales, trading, and market-making services in almost every type of financial instrument in all the world’s financial markets. Morgan Stanley professionals use our network and technology to provide liquidity and sophisticated analysis, to manage risk and execute reliably in the fast-changing markets.
Morgan Stanley’s Institutional Equity Division (IED) is a world leader in the origination, distribution and trading of equity, equity-linked and equity-derivative securities. Our broad and deep client relationships, market-leading platform and intellectual insights enable us to be a world-class service provider to our clients for their financing, market access and portfolio management needs.
Global Markets Group is the offshoring arm of Morgan Stanley’s Sales & Trading businesses in India. It covers functions across IED ranging from those associated with sales, trading, analytics, Strat’s to risk management.
Primary Responsibilities
The candidate will be based out of Mumbai and will be primarily working with the Corporate Derivatives Desk Trading (Hong Kong/Singapore) along with regular support to Convertible Bonds Desk. The role suits a self-motivated, highly energetic individual who has a strong background in Financial Research / Trading Support & Analytics. The role offers great opportunity to the candidates to build on their knowledge of and exposure to Equity Derivative products, risks as well as valuation.
The role also offers a unique opportunity of exposure into Derivative Trade Pricing, Quantitative / financial analysis across varied industries/sector combined with working on trading related activities for the desk.
Responsibilities For This Role Would Involve
- Work on uplifting front end Derivatives pricing sheets, cross checking and back testing strategies.
- Providing detailed Quantitative Analysis &/or Financial Analysis.
- Assist in trading desk in activities like trade bookings, TLC process, including setups.
- Checking of trade bookings, working with collateral and operations teams on reconciliations.
Skills Required (essential)
- BMS/Engineers Graduates with MBAs and/or CFA (preferred but not must)
- 1-6 years’ work experience in Quantitative / Financial analysis roles, within Banking/Financial Services firms
- Experience in Python and/or SQL must.
- Coursework/Strong understanding in Finance & Derivatives
- Good communication skills – written as well as telephonic. There will be regular communication with the trading desk and the person needs to be able to understand the requirements and express their thoughts clearly.
- High level of attention to detail
- Proficiency in MS Office products – Excel, PowerPoint
